Abstract

Reaction of γ-Al 20 3 with CCl 4 has been investigated up to about 900 K in a quartz microreactor attached to a quadrupole mass spectrometer. Surface reaction starts at about 400 K as detected by the formation of COCl 2CO 2 and Cl 2. Volatilization of γ-Al 20 3 by the formation of AlCl 3, with a slight amount of Al 2Cl 6 becomes detectable above 600 K. According to the expected stoichiometry, CO 2 is the only other major reaction product up to 900 K.
